Blackberry Peach Old Fashioned Recipe

Time8m
Serves1

with Woodford Reserve bourbon, peach preserves, one muddled blackberry, Angostura bitters, and a lemon twist

Method

Prepare Glass & Fruit

1

Chill glass (optional)

If desired, place the old fashioned glass in the freezer for 5–10 minutes or fill briefly with ice water, then discard before building the cocktail.

2

Muddle blackberry with preserves

Place the fresh blackberry and the 1/2 tablespoon peach preserves into the bottom of a mixing glass or directly in the old fashioned glass. Using a muddler or the back of a bar spoon, gently muddle until the blackberry is broken and the preserves are combined and slightly pulpy. Avoid over-muddling to prevent excessive bitterness from seeds.

Build Cocktail

3

Add the bourbon (2 oz) to the mixing glass with the muddled fruit and preserves.

4

Add 3 dashes of Angostura bitters. If you prefer slightly sweeter balance because the preserves taste tart, add 1/4 tsp simple syrup. Stir gently to combine the ingredients and slightly dissolve the preserves into the spirit (about 15–20 seconds).

5

Fill the old fashioned glass with a large ice cube (or several large cubes). If you built the drink in a separate mixing glass, strain the mixture over the ice into the chilled glass using a fine strainer or julep strainer to keep most seeds and pulp out; if you built it in the serving glass, simply add the ice on top and give one gentle stir to chill and integrate the drink.

Finish & Garnish

6

Express the lemon oils over the drink: hold a lemon peel about 3–4 inches above the glass (pith-side down) and give it a firm twist to spray oils onto the surface. Run the peel around the rim if desired.

7

Drop the twist into the glass and optionally garnish with an extra blackberry on a pick. Give the cocktail one final gentle stir (3–4 turns) to marry flavors, then serve.
